What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Full Time Purchasing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Full Time Purchasing Manager, you need strong negotiation skills, analytical abilities, and a solid understanding of supply chain management, typically supported by a bachelor's deg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with procurement software (such as SAP or Oracle) and relevant certifications like Certified Professional in Supply Management (CPSM) are often required.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ills help build strong vendor relationships and manage cross-functional teams. These competencies ensure cost-effective purchasing, reliable supply chains, and overall organizational efficiency.

What are Full Time Purchasing Managers?

Full Time Purchasing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ing a company's procurement activities on a full-time basis. They manage the sourcing, negotiation, and purchase of goods and services needed for business operations. Their role involves developing purchasing strategies, maintaining relationships with suppliers, and ensuring that materials are acquired at the best possible price and quality. Purchasing Managers also monitor inventory levels, review contracts, and ensure compliance with company policies and regulations. Their work is crucial for optimizing costs and supporting the overall supply chain efficiency.

What is the difference between Full Time Purchasing Manager vs Purchasing Agent?

AspectFull Time Purchasing ManagerPurchasing Agent
ResponsibilitiesOversees procurement strategies, manages supplier relationships, and negotiates contractsExecutes purchasing orders, sources suppliers, and assists in procurement processes
CredentialsBachelor's degree in supply chain, business, or related field; experience in procurementH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certification or training
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, often in manufacturing, retail, or logistics companiesOffice or warehouse environment, often in retail or distribution centers

While both roles involve procurement, a Full Time Purchasing Manager typically handles strategic planning and supplier negotiations, whereas a Purchasing Agent focuses on executing purchase orders and sourcing. The Purchasing Manager role usually requires more experience and higher-level credentials, reflecting its broader responsibilities in the procurement process.

What are some common challenges a Purchasing Manager faces when working with multiple vendors and how can they be addressed?

Purchasing Managers often juggle relationships with numerous vendors, each with different pricing structures, delivery schedules, and quality standards. Challenges can include maintaining clear communication, managing supply chain disruptions, and negotiating favorable contract terms. To address these, it's crucial to establish transparent communication channels, utilize procurement software for tracking orders and performance, and regularly review vendor performance to ensure expectations are met. Building strong, professional relationships and setting clear expectations from the outset can also help mitigate potential issues.

Position Summary
The Purchasing Manager manages all aspects of product forecasting, sourcing, purchasing, and inventory functions to meet the company's short-term and long-term supply chain management/inventory control requirements, while pursuing further cost reductions in our fast-paced manufacturing enterprise. This position will lead the Purchasing team by providing support and training to all Buyers and will facilitate existing Supplier relations and cultivate new partnerships.
Essential functions of the Purchasing Manager
  • Manage sourcing, planning, and purchasing activities to ensure timely receipt of materials while meeting quality and cost expectations aligned with business objectives.
  • Lead/support Buyers in developing and maintaining supplier contracts and agreements for raw materials, services, and maintenance, repair, and operating (MRO) supplies.
  • Assist with system optimization and ongoing maintenance of MRP data to ensure accuracy and efficiency.
  • Serve as a key liaison between the organization and suppliers, managing procurement-related communications such as quotations, purchase orders, contracts, and issue resolution.
  • Build and maintain strong, collaborative relationships with suppliers to support performance and reliability.
  • Partner with internal departments to proactively identify, escalate, and resolve supplier-related issues.
  • Monitor inventory levels within assigned categories and take action to optimize availability while balancing working capital.
  • Collaborate cross-functionally to identify and implement cost savings and continuous improvement initiatives within materials management.
  • Analyze purchasing activities and generate reports to track performance and support decision-making.
  • Conduct in-depth analysis of supply chain challenges, particularly related to material availability, inventory levels, and cost drivers.
  • Partner with Engineering to support sourcing activities for new product development.

Qualifications and Skills
  • 5+ years of experience leading sourcing and purchasing functions within a manufacturing environment.
  • Bachelor's degree in Supply Chain Management, Business, Engineering, or related field.
  • Strong communication, negotiation, and contract management skills, with the ability to influence and build effective partnerships.
  • APICS (CPIM) and/or ISM (CPM) certification preferred, demonstrating commitment to professional development in supply chain practices.
  • Experience with ERP systems, including a solid understanding of MRP process, data integrity, and system-driven planning logic.
  • Demonstrated pro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Outlook, Excel, Word, PowerPoint, & Teams), including the ability to create, analyze, and communicate information using standard business applications.
